export interface ConsoleLogEntry { id: string; level: "log" | "error" | "warn" | "info" | "debug" | "trace"; args: any[]; timestamp: string; url?: string; } interface UseIframeConsoleOptions { enabled?: boolean; maxLogs?: number; proxyToPageConsole?: boolean; } /** * Hook to manage console logs from iframes */ export declare function useIframeConsole(options?: UseIframeConsoleOptions): { logs: ConsoleLogEntry[]; addLog: (entry: Omit) => void; clearLogs: () => void; isOpen: boolean; setIsOpen: import("react").Dispatch>; }; export {}; //# sourceMappingURL=useIframeConsole.d.ts.map